Miso Salmon Bowl

This Miso Salmon Bowl is inspired by the Miso-Glazed Salmon Bowl from Sweetgreen. Tasty and healthy, this rice bowl is worth the effort.
Prep Time35 minutes
Cook Time10 minutes
Servings: 2 bowls

Ingredients

Miso-Glazed Salmon

  • 1 lb salmon fillet
  • 3 tbsp white miso
  • 3 tbsp so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p mirin
  • 1 tbsp maple syrup
  • 2 tsp rice vinegar
  • 1 tsp sesame oil

Seasoned Rice

  • 2 cups medium-grain wild or white rice
  • 1 tsp rice vinegar
  • 1/4 tsp salt

Nori-Sesame Seasoning

  • 2 tbsp toasted sesame seeds
  • 1 sheet nori, crumbled or cut into ¼-inch pieces
  • ½ tsp sugar
  • ¼ tsp salt

Toppings

  • ¼ cup pickled red onions
  • ½ cucumber, sliced into ½-inch cubes
  • 1 avocado, thinly sliced
  • ¼ cup crispy onions or wonton strips
  • ½ cup spicy cashew dressing (see recipe link in Notes section below)

Instructions

Miso-Glazed Salmon

  • Whisk together the white miso, soy sauce, mirin, maple syrup, rice vinegar, and sesame oil.
  • Brush the glaze onto the salmon and marinate the fillet in the refrigerator for 20 minutes.
  • Preheat the oven to 400F/205C. Prepare a baking sheet by covering it with aluminum foil. Bake the fillet at 400F for 8 minutes.
  • Increase the temperature to 500F/260C and place the fillet near the top of the oven to broil for 2 minutes.

Seasoned Rice

  • Cook the rice per package instructions.
  • Toss the cooked rice in the rice vinegar and salt.
  • Add 1 cup of rice to each bowl and top with half of the salmon fillet each.

Nori-Sesame Seasoning

  • Whisk together the sesame seeds, nori, sugar, and salt. Sprinkle on top of the bowl.

Toppings

  • Add the pickled red onions, cucumber, avocado, crispy onions or wonton strips, and spicy cashew dressing to the bowl and serve.
